Scriv also has much better integration with other writer's tools like Aeon Timeline and Tinderbox. it's more than 700 pages of US letter format text, and it's very well-written. a lot of the more advanced features like wiki-like transclusion aren't immediately visible on the surface, but you should download the PDF manual. (And Scrivener is cheaper too, although that doesn't factor into it for me.) The feature set in Scriv3 is just so deep. Now I think the advantage for Scrivener on the Mac is just so overwhelming that it's not even a contest. I haven't had problems with sync, but I like the fact that even if I did have problems, the raw files are still available on Dropbox in clean, non-proprietary file formats.īefore Scrivener 3, I think there was more of an argument that Ulysses and Scrivener on the Mac were comparable.
